Esempio n. 1
0
void
Debug(const char *fmt, ...)
{
   va_list args;
   va_start(args, fmt);
   if (gGuestSDKMode) {
      GuestSDK_Debug(fmt, args);
   } else {
      VMToolsLogWrapper(G_LOG_LEVEL_DEBUG, fmt, args);
   }
   va_end(args);
}
Esempio n. 2
0
void
Debug(const char *fmt, ...)
{
   va_list args;
   va_start(args, fmt);
   if (gGuestSDKMode) {
      GuestSDK_Debug(fmt, args);
   } else {
      /*
       * Preserve errno/lastError.
       * This keeps compatibility with bora/lib Log(), preventing
       * Log() calls in bora/lib code from clobbering errno/lastError.
       */
      WITH_ERRNO(err, VMToolsLogWrapper(G_LOG_LEVEL_DEBUG, fmt, args));
   }
   va_end(args);
}